Re: R8000 nighthawk Config issue lack of service

What Firmware version is currently loaded?
What is the Mfr and model# of the Internet Service Providers modem/ONT the NG router is connected too?
Be sure your using a good quality LAN cable between the modem and router. CAT6 is recommended. 

 

What channels are you using? Auto? Try Auto and 48 on 5Ghz. Or try setting manual channel 1, 6 or 11 on 2.4Ghz and 40 to 48 channel on 5Ghz.
Any Wifi Neighbors near by? If so, how many?

 

Has a factory reset and setup from scratch been performed since last FW update?

Re: R8000 nighthawk Config issue lack of service


@vdotmatrix wrote:

I do not know how do downgrade the firmware. Is it easy to do?


Pretty easy. It is the same process as a manual update of the firmware.

 

How do I manually upgrade firmware to my NETGEAR router? | Answer | NETGEAR Support

 


I have the nighthawk app installed on the phone and ipad…

 


I don't think that you can use that for anything beyond basic housekeeping in a router.

 

Manual updates are usually done with a wired LAN connection using the browser graphical user interface (GUI).

Re: R8000 nighthawk Config issue lack of service


@vdotmatrix wrote:

I’ve had this issue with this router for over a year.


What issue?

 


.... the guy try to sell me a contract for support saying that it was a configuration issue with our wireless router. So if it was a configuration issue wouldn’t a factory reset solve the issue? 

You get free support for 90 days after you buy the router. That is essentially there to help you through the setup process.

 

After that, you have to pay. Netgear does not provide that support. It farms that out to Gearhead.

 

GearHead Support

 


So if it was a configuration issue wouldn’t a factory reset solve the issue? 


Only if you set it up properly to fit in with the rest of your network. Which is where the questions from @plemans come in.
